Abstract: Nuclear structure in the stability valley is dominated by the mean field concept where neutrons and protons create their own potential and the most appropriate description is offered by the shell model. Near the drip line, the low binding energy allows molecular-like structures. Recent theoretical works predict in the case of self-conjugated 4n nuclei with excitation energies around the 4n decay threshold and symmetric diluted nuclear matter bose condensation of alpha particles, that is, a new phase of nuclear matter. We aim to investigate the alpha particle bose condensate nature of excited quasiprojectiles obtained in the nuclear reactions 36ar+58ni with beam energies of 32, 52 and 95 mev/nucleon rnd 40ca+12c with beam energy 25 mev/nucleon. The first system was measured in Ganil, Caen (France) using the indra 4pi detector; the second system was measured at lns-catania (Italy) using the chimera 4pi detector.
We shall select the bose condensate candidate events, test the simultaneity degree of the decay process, restore the emitting sources properties, characterize them using especially designed multiparticle correlation functions. Numerical simulations will be used to estimate possible distorsions caused by imperfect detection. We stress that the useof heavy-ion reactions at several tens mev/nucleon incident energy and 4pi detectors. Previously developed for nuclear multifragmentation in order to study the Nuclear structure in excited states is a world premiere. Our participation to such a study and access to experimental data are possible due to a long collaboration with the authors of both experiments.
Once experimentally evidenced, the bose condensation of nuclear matter will be one of the most remarkable achievements of the last decades.
